Solar green roofs are gaining in importance
The market for solar green roofs is growing rapidly. In many cities and states, green roofs are already required or specifically subsidized for new construction and major roof renovations. At the same time, the demand for locally generated solar power is increasing.
The combination of solar power and green roofs therefore offers great potential for sustainable urban development: Green roofs improve the microclimate, reduce the heating of buildings and cities, create habitats for plants and insects, and contribute to rainwater retention. Solar power systems also benefit from the natural cooling effect of the greenery, which can lead to higher electricity yields.

ECOgreen®: Green roof system with integrated ballast
PURUS PLASTICS has been developing solutions for blue-green infrastructure for over 30 years. With ECOgreen®, the company offers a modular green roof system that combines vegetation and the required dead load in a single solution.
The system consists of a securely interlocked modular grid of base plates into which sedum boxes are inserted. The elements are delivered to the construction site already planted with vegetation. This eliminates the need for the usual on-site establishment period, and the roof surface achieves its full functionality and appearance immediately after installation.
A particular advantage lies in the system’s dual function: The greenery simultaneously provides the dead weight required for the photovoltaic system. This eliminates the need for additional ballast stones.
The plastic building blocks of the ECOgreen® system are made from packaging and film waste collected in the "Yellow Bag" and are fully recyclable even after decades of use.
PMT EVO GREEN: Mounting solution for modern green solar roofs
PMT has been developing and manufacturing high-quality photovoltaic mounting systems in Germany since 2012. With " PMT EVO GREEN ," the company offers a mounting solution specifically designed for green roofs that optimally combines solar energy with green roofing.
The system is based on the proven PMT EVO technology and allows for flexible planning to meet a variety of roofing requirements. Depending on the green roof design, various system heights are available. This creates optimal conditions for plant growth, ventilation, maintenance, and the reliable operation of the photovoltaic system.
PMT EVO GREEN It also takes into account the requirements of modern solar green roofs, including row spacing and clearances between vegetation and modules. The innovative click technology enables quick and secure installation on the construction site.
An additional advantage: " PMT EVO GREEN " is based on a substructure tested by the German Institute for Building Technology (DIBt) that has received general building authority approval (abZ), thereby providing additional planning certainty for all project participants.
